Generadores de aire caliente agrícolas de 46 a 180 kW - SERIE AM
Equipos totalmente autónomos y de sencilla instalación adecuados para la calefacción con aire caliente de invernaderos, granjas, almacenes, naves industriales, procesos de secado, etc.
Principales características:
- Equipos totalmente compactos y robustos.
- Intercambiador tubular con un rendimiento superior al 89%.
- Terminación exterior en acero galvanizado de calidad.
- Aislamiento térmico mediante cámara de aire y/o fibra de vidrio.
- Grupo ventilador centrífugo de 1 velocidad de gran caudal de aire.
- Cuadro eléctrico de maniobra y protección según normas europeas.
- Salida de aire en la parte opuesta al quemador donde se puede aplicar rejilla de aire caliente o red de conductos.
- Posibilidad de aplicar manillar y ruedas para su fácil transporte.
Combustibles admitidos:
- Gasóleo.
- Gas natural.
- Gas propano.
Potencias disponibles:
46 a 180 kW
Caudal de aire:
De 3.400 a 13.300 m3/h
Capacidad de calefacción:
De 990 a 3.875 m3
Aplicaciones:
Invernaderos, granjas, almacenes, naves industriales, procesos de secado, etc.

For designers, it can be daunting to navigate the evolving landscape of web design and development and comprehend their specific roles. Here is an overview of the website creation process, outlining designers' responsibilities, the involvement of other professionals, and the essential skill sets required.
What is the difference between Web design and Web Development.pdfMPIRIC Software
web design refers to the process of designing and creating the visual elements of a website, such as the layout, colors, and typography, web development involves the coding and programming that brings the design to life.
